Schița de curs

Înțelegerea suprafețelor de browser Antigravity

  • Cum funcționează suprafața de browser
  • Capacități și limitări principale
  • Considerente de securitate și sandboxing

Construirea agentilor care interacționează cu web

  • Configurarea comportamentului agentilor pentru acțiuni de browser
  • Click-uri, tipărirea, scrolul și modele de selecție
  • Gestionarea interacțiunilor sincrone și asincrone

Conștientizarea DOM și țintuirea elementelor

  • Cum interpretă agenții structura HTML
  • Selecționarea elementelor în mod fiabil
  • Gestionarea conținutului dinamic și a framework-urilor reactiv

Automatizarea fluxurilor de lucru end-to-end

  • Proiectarea fluxurilor de browser multi-etapă
  • Gestionarea tranzițiilor de stare între sarcini
  • Automatizarea autentificării, navigației și a fluxurilor de formular

Testarea UI cu Antigravity

  • Verificarea comportamentului UI folosind check-uri drivate de agenți
  • Capturarea dovezi și stări de eroare
  • Înregistrări de browser și depunerea erorilor bazată pe redare

Fluxuri cross-surface și multi-context

  • Combinarea suprafețelor de browser și non-browser
  • Gestionarea schimbărilor de context ale fluxurilor de lucru
  • Asigurarea consistenței între suprafețe

Depanare și optimizare

  • Diagnosticarea dezaliniării agentilor cu conținutul de browser
  • Optimizarea pentru rapiditate și fiabilitate
  • Modele frecvente de eșec și soluții

Integrarea Antigravity în pipeline-urile de dezvoltare

  • Încorporarea fluxurilor de lucru în CI/CD
  • Coordonarea cu echipa QA și dev
  • Versionarea și menținerea comportamentului agentilor

Rezumat și următoarele pași

Cerințe

  • O înțelegere a fluxurilor de lucru ale aplicațiilor bazate pe browser
  • Experiență cu script-uri sau unelte de automatizare
  • Familiaritate cu conceptele de dezvoltare web

Audience

  • Dezvoltatori web
  • Ingineri de automatizare a testelor
  • Dezvoltatori front-end
 21 ore

Numărul de participanți


Pret per participant

Cursuri viitoare

Categorii înrudite